This is a professional tool developed to help scientists calculate and convert pharmacokinetic (PK) parameters based on the relationships between them in various compartment models. : It converts parameters such as clearance ( CLcap C cap L ), volume of distribution ( ), and elimination rate constants ( kelk sub e l end-sub ) across 1, 2, and 3-compartment models.
